INDEXPROPERTY 索引的度查询
上一篇 /
下一篇 2008-11-11 13:30:13
/ 个人分类:数据库
INDEXPROPERTY 中的几个查询属性
属性 | 说明 | 值 |
---|
IndexDepth | 索引的深度。 | 索引级别数。NULL = XML 索引或输入无效。 |
IndexFillFactor | 创建索引或最后重新生成索引时使用的填充因子值。 | 填充因子 |
IndexID | 指定表或索引视图上索引的索引 ID。 | 索引 ID |
IsAutoStatistics | 统计信息是由 ALTER DATABASE 的 AUTO_CREATE_STATISTICS 选项生成的。 | 1=True0=False 或 XML 索引。 |
IsClustered | 索引是聚集的。 | 1=True0=False 或 XML 索引。 |
IsDisabled | 索引被禁用。 | 1=True0=FalseNULL=输入无效。 |
IsFulltextKey | 索引是表的全文键。 | 1=True0=False 或 XML 索引。NULL=输入无效。 |
IsHypothetical | 索引是假设的,不能直接用作数据访问路径。假设索引包含列级统计信息,由数据库引擎优化顾问维护和使用。 | 1=True0=False 或 XML 索引NULL=输入无效。 |
IsPadIndex | 索引指定每个内部节点上将要保持空闲的空间。 | 1=True0=False 或 XML 索引。 |
IsPageLockDisallowed | 通过 ALTER INDEX 的 ALLOW_PAGE_LOCKS 选项设置的页锁定值。 | 1=不允许页锁定0=允许页锁定。NULL=输入无效。 |
IsRowLockDisallowed | 通过 ALTER INDEX 的 ALLOW_ROW_LOCKS 选项设置的行锁定值。 | 1=不允许行锁定。0=允许行锁定。NULL = 输入无效。 |
IsStatistics | index_or_statistics_name是通过 CREATE STATISTICS 语句或 ALTER DATABASE 的 AUTO_CREATE_STATISTICS 选项创建的统计信息。 | 1=True 0=False 或 XML 索引。 |
IsUnique | 索引是唯一的。 | 1=True0=False 或 XML 索引。 |
如:查看索引的深度
SQL 脚本如下:
select INDEXPROPERTY (OBJECT_ID('ChargeHeap'),'ChargeHeap_NCInd','IndexDepth')
其中的 'ChargeHeap' 为我们要查看索引所在的表名,'ChargeHeap_NCInd' 为所要查看的索引名,'IndexDepth' 为所要查看的索引属性。
相关阅读:
- sql中的表连接 (chenjie021, 2008-11-04)
- Oracle常见错误及处理办法(整理) (Jon, 2008-11-05)
- 索引分析和优化 (chenjie021, 2008-11-05)
- 查询锁的表含义(sp_lock) (chenjie021, 2008-11-05)
- oracle之SQL学习笔记 (Jon, 2008-11-05)
- SQL中的N (chenjie021, 2008-11-07)
- SQL中的聚集索引和非聚集索引的区别 (chenjie021, 2008-11-07)
- SQL提高速度注意事项 (chenjie021, 2008-11-10)
- SQL 中having (chenjie021, 2008-11-10)
- 三种调优查询的主要的方法 (chenjie021, 2008-11-10)
收藏
举报
TAG:
数据库